Egan population

How many people live in Egan

Egan is home to 19 residents, according to the most recent Census data. Gender-wise, 52.6% of Egan locals are male, and 42.1% are female.

Age demographics

The median age in Egan is 49, with the population distributed as follows: about 15.8% are children under 15, then 10.5% are in the 15 to 24 age group. Adults between 25 and 44 make up 21% of the population, while another 31.6% fall into the 45 to 64 bracket. Finally, around 21% are 65 or older.

Households in Egan

A peek inside Egan households

Egan has 7 households, with an average of 2 members in each. Of these, 71.4% are families, while the remaining 28.6% are made up of individuals living alone or with non-relatives, such as roommates.

The age of buildings in Egan

In Egan, the median construction year is 1959. Most development happened in the second half of the 20th century.

Egan housing costs

Housing costs in Egan come to a median of $983 per month, while tenants specifically pay a median gross rent of $764.

Income in Egan

How much people earn in Egan

The average annual household income in Egan was $102,278 in 2024, the most recent annual data available, according to the U.S. Census Bureau. This marked a +8.8% change from the previous year. At the same time, the median income stood at $86,056, reflecting a +12.6% shift over the same period.

Employment in Egan

Workforce and job types in Egan

66.7% of the working population are employed in professional or administrative positions, while 33.3% are in hands-on or service-based jobs. Also, 11.1% run their own businesses, 66.7% are employed by private companies, and 11.1% work in the public sector.
